Web19 aug. 2024 · Microwave chocolate chips for 15 seconds on high and remove to stir. Repeat with 5 to 10 second increments until most of the chips are melted. Add oil, butter, or shortening to thin a small amount of chocolate. The best way to thin chocolate is with the addition of a fat.
